AI Summary

  • Establishes priority reimbursement order for dry cleaner environmental response account expenditures, prioritizing persons meeting specific conditions and commissioner response actions when owners fail to complete required actions.

  • Prohibits the use of perchloroethylene as a dry cleaning solvent after December 31, 2025.

  • Cancels an estimated $255,000 in unexpended funds from Laws 2019, First Special Session chapter 4, article 1, section 2, subdivision 10, paragraph (c).

  • Appropriates $355,000 in fiscal year 2021 from the remediation fund for a cost-share program to reimburse dry cleaning facility owners and operators for transition costs to alternative solvents, up to $20,000 per facility, available until June 30, 2024.

  • Appropriates $213,000 in fiscal year 2021 from the dry cleaner environmental response and reimbursement account for environmental response purposes, available until June 30, 2022.

Legislative Description

Dry cleaner environmental response and reimbursement account expenditures prioritized, perchloroethylene banned, prior appropriation canceled, cost-share program and environmental response cost funding provided, and money appropriated.
